Earrings are often understated pieces of jewelry; women and girls can wear simple metal or stone studs day after day. But in the past few years, unique earrings have been popular as statement pieces. Chandelier-style earrings are commonly seen everywhere from Hollywood red carpets to small-town offices. Dramatic drop earrings look great with pulled-back hairstyles, often showcasing beautiful gemstones. And hoop earrings, large or small, beaded or bejeweled, are classic alternatives to plain studs.
Unique earrings work best when they’re the focus of a look. Pair chandelier earrings with a solid, strapless dress, and pull your hair back for even more drama. Wear an outfit in a muted color with bright earrings to make them pop. Mix and match clothing and earring styles, too – you can pair casual jeans and a t-shirt with dressier earrings for an unexpected look.
